BeyondTrust is seeking an HR Business Partner for International Sales to provide strategic HR consultation and partnership across EMEA and APAC. This critical role supports the business by fostering trusted relationships and addressing complex organizational challenges.

The ideal candidate will have extensive HR experience, strong business acumen, and the ability to influence at all levels within the organization. They will ensure compliance with local laws while aligning people strategies with commercial goals, driving organizational effectiveness across diverse teams.

How to prepare for a job interview at BeyondTrust

Brush Up on HR Best Practices

As you're diving into human resources, it’s crucial to be well-versed in the latest HR practices and legislation. Get familiar with key topics like employee engagement, talent acquisition, and diversity initiatives, as these could easily pop up in your interview with BeyondTrust.

Know Your Recruitment Tools

Most HR roles involve using various recruitment tools and ATS (Applicant Tracking Systems). Make sure you can comfortably discuss platforms like Workday or Greenhouse. If you've had direct experience, share those examples; if not, show your eagerness to learn!

Highlight Your People Skills

A full-time HR role at BeyondTrust will require strong interpersonal skills. Prepare to share stories that demonstrate how you’ve successfully navigated conflicts or supported team members in past experiences. Authenticity goes a long way in this field.

Stay Current with HR Trends

Being up to speed with current HR trends, like remote working protocols or mental health initiatives, can set you apart. Be ready to discuss how these trends could impact BeyondTrust and how you would contribute to adapting HR strategies.
